Egypt may have a troubled recent past but there's business to be done and families to send items to via international courier services.
The country is only six others that cross continental boundaries. The others are
Azerbaijan,
Georgia, Kazakhstan, Russia,
Turkey and Panama. It's also one of the most populous countries in either Africa or the Middle East with no fewer than eighty-one million inhabitants.
The history of the country is as well-documented as it is lengthy, with many of the world's most important historic sites located within its borders.
Today much of Egypt's economy is dependent on petroleum exports and tourism, with a degree of agricultural exports too. Of course the Suez Canal is also a very significant income source and delivers many millions of Egyptian Pounds into the
Ministry of Finance every year.
When sending parcels to Egypt it is important to note that DVDs, CDs and Videos are subject to censorship. Furthermore, many types of office equipment may be subject to inspection by the Anti-Forgery Department. Also telephony and satellite equipment must be approved.
It would be advisable not to send any jewellery by international courier services into the country either.
Pornography, firearms are prohibited an alcoholic beverages can be penalised with import duty of anything up to 3000%.
You'll need a
pro forma invoice, a certificate of origin, a commercial invoice and a packing list.
